ngFor是Angular框架中的一个指令,用于在模板中循环渲染数据。ngStyle是Angular框架中的一个指令,用于动态设置元素的样式。
在ngFor循环中,如果想要根据某个条件来设置元素的样式,可以使用ngStyle指令。对于状态为"checked"的元素,可以通过ngStyle指令来设置其样式。
下面是一个示例代码:
<div *ngFor="let item of items">
<input type="checkbox" [checked]="item.checked" [ngStyle]="{'color': item.checked ? 'green' : 'red'}">
{{ item.name }}
</div>
在上述代码中,items是一个包含多个对象的数组,每个对象都有一个checked属性和一个name属性。ngFor指令用于循环渲染数组中的每个对象,并将其显示在页面上。ngStyle指令用于根据item.checked的值来设置checkbox元素的颜色样式,如果item.checked为true,则设置为绿色,否则设置为红色。
推荐的腾讯云相关产品和产品介绍链接地址:
以上是腾讯云提供的一些相关产品,可以根据具体需求选择适合的产品来支持ngFor循环中状态为"checked"的ngStyle。
领取专属 10元无门槛券
手把手带您无忧上云